Output e8c0567eceb76c7a770f2378db5d85cbb0288d1fce2f1e671d34d53d63950820:4

value
576830
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cb52d748c72948c19f724f4b89385607c31f30a435c2decb82905dfcc0771726
address
tb1pedfdwjx899yvr8mjfa9cjwzkqlp37v9yxhpdajuzjpwlesrhzunqrpgzjq
transaction
e8c0567eceb76c7a770f2378db5d85cbb0288d1fce2f1e671d34d53d63950820
confirmations
20967
spent
true